Research Coins: Electronic Auction

 
225, Lot: 389. Estimate $150.
Sold for $575. This amount does not include the buyer’s fee.

Severus Alexander. AD 222-235. Æ Sestertius (29mm, 18.09 g, 12h). Rome mint. Struck AD 229. Laureate bust right, slight drapery on far shoulder / Severus Alexander, holding eagle-tipped scepter, driving triumphal quadriga right. RIC IV 495. VF, brown patina, heavy tooling and smoothing.
